At present, TTO (thermal transfer coding) high-speed coding carbon strip technology is constantly innovating and developing to meet the growing printing needs and high efficiency production requirements. The following are some of the new TTO high-speed coding carbon strip technologies:
1. High-resolution printing technology
High resolution ink layer: The new TTO carbon strip uses a high resolution ink layer to achieve finer and clearer printing results. This technology makes the printed text, bar code, image and other information more accurate, to meet the strict requirements of the printing quality of the application scenario.
2. Environmentally friendly materials
Environmentally friendly ink: With the enhancement of environmental awareness, more and more TTO carbon belt began to use environmentally friendly ink. These inks do not produce harmful substances during use, are environmentally friendly, and also meet a growing number of industry environmental standards.
3. Durability enhancement technology
Enhanced coating: In order to improve the durability of the TTO carbon belt, some suppliers add an enhanced coating to the surface of the carbon belt. This coating can increase the wear resistance, chemical resistance and scratch resistance of the carbon strip, so that the printed content can remain clear for a long time in harsh environments.
4. Fast drying technology
Efficient heat transfer materials: The new TTO carbon strip may use efficient heat transfer materials to speed up heat transfer and ink drying during the printing process. This technology helps to improve printing efficiency, reduce waiting times, and increase the overall production capacity of the production line.
5. Customized services
Customization: In order to meet the specific needs of different customers, some TTO carbon belt suppliers offer customized services. Customers can customize the type, specifications, ink color and other parameters of the carbon belt according to their own application scenarios and printing requirements to obtain the best printing effect and use experience.
6. Intelligent control technology
Intelligent temperature control: In high-end TTO high-speed coding systems, intelligent temperature control technology may be integrated. This technology can monitor the temperature of the print head in real time and automatically adjust the temperature parameters according to the print content to ensure the stability and consistency of the print quality.
7. New back coating technology
Low friction back coating: New TTO carbon strips may use low friction back coating technology to reduce friction resistance between the print head and the carbon strip. This technology helps to extend the life of the print head, reduce maintenance costs, and improve overall printing efficiency.
